How Long Does Basement Waterproofing Last?

You’ve invested in waterproofing your basement. Now you’re probably wondering how long this protection will last. It’s a fair question!

The good news is that a properly installed and maintained basement waterproofing system can offer protection for a very long time. Many systems are designed to last for many years, often 15 to 20 years or even longer.

However, “lifespan” isn’t a one-size-fits-all number. Several factors influence how long your waterproofing will hold up against moisture and water intrusion.

Factors Influencing Waterproofing Lifespan

Think of your waterproofing like a good quality roof. It needs to be built right and kept in good shape to do its job effectively.

The type of waterproofing is a big one. Interior drainage systems, exterior membranes, and sealants all have different expected lifespans.

Material quality plays a huge role. Higher-quality, durable materials will naturally last longer than cheaper alternatives. We found that premium products often come with longer manufacturer warranties, which is a good indicator of expected longevity.

Installation Quality Matters

Even the best materials won’t perform well if they aren’t installed correctly. A flawless installation by experienced professionals is critical.

This includes proper preparation of surfaces, correct application of sealants or membranes, and ensuring drainage systems are properly sloped. Poor installation is a leading cause for why basement waterproofing sometimes fails after a few years. This can lead to unexpected repairs and frustration.

Environmental Conditions and Your Home’s Structure

Your home’s surroundings can also impact your basement waterproofing. Think about things like soil pressure and groundwater levels.

Heavy clay soils can exert more pressure on foundation walls. Consistent high water tables mean your system is working harder. We also found that issues originating above ground, like clogged gutters or poor grading, can put extra stress on basement waterproofing. Signs Your Waterproofing Might Be Failing

Even the best systems can eventually wear down or encounter issues. It’s important to know the warning signs so you can address them before they become major problems.

The most obvious sign is recurring dampness or moisture in your basement. This could be visible on walls or floors. You might also notice a persistent musty odor.

Mold and mildew growth are serious basement moisture warning signs. If you see any fuzzy or discolored patches, it’s time to investigate. Even small leaks that seem manageable can indicate a breakdown in your waterproofing.

What to Look For

Keep an eye out for:

  • Musty smells that don’t go away.
  • Visible water stains on walls or floors.
  • Peeling paint or crumbling drywall.
  • Mold or mildew growth.
  • Puddles or standing water after rain.

Maintenance: The Key to Longevity

Just like your car needs oil changes, your basement waterproofing needs a little TLC to perform its best. Regular maintenance is not just recommended; it’s essential for maximizing the lifespan of your investment.

Most experts agree that proactive maintenance is far more cost-effective than reactive repairs. It helps prevent minor issues from escalating into costly water damage.

Regular Inspections and Cleaning

We found that simply keeping gutters clean and ensuring downspouts direct water away from your foundation is a huge help. This reduces the amount of water that reaches your basement walls and drainage systems.

Periodically inspect your basement for any new cracks or signs of moisture. If you have an interior drainage system, ensure the sump pump is working correctly. Test it by pouring water into the sump pit to make sure it activates and pumps water out.

Understanding Different Waterproofing Types

There are various approaches to basement waterproofing. Knowing the difference can help you understand what might have been done and what might be needed in the future.

Interior waterproofing typically involves a drainage system installed beneath the basement floor and sometimes along the walls. This system collects water and directs it to a sump pump. It’s generally easier to install and less disruptive.

Exterior waterproofing involves excavating around the foundation and applying a waterproof membrane or coating. This is often considered more robust but is also more expensive and labor-intensive. It can address basement foundation moisture problems at the source.

Sometimes, a combination of both interior and exterior methods offers the most complete protection. Understanding what is interior vs. exterior basement waterproofing can help you make informed decisions.

Waterproofing Method Typical Lifespan Pros Cons
Interior Drainage Systems 15-20+ years Less invasive, cost-effective installation Relies on sump pump, doesn’t stop wall leaks
Exterior Membranes/Coatings 20-30+ years Stops water at the source, very durable Expensive, disruptive excavation
Sealants/Epoxies 5-10 years (surface applications) Quick, easy for minor cracks Temporary fix, doesn’t address hydrostatic pressure

How often should I inspect my basement for moisture?

It’s a good practice to conduct a visual inspection of your basement at least twice a year, ideally in the spring and fall. Pay close attention after heavy rainstorms or significant snowmelt, as these events can put extra stress on your home’s drainage and waterproofing systems.

Can minor basement cracks be sealed permanently?

Small, non-structural cracks can often be sealed effectively with appropriate epoxies or hydraulic cements. However, it’s crucial to determine the cause of the crack. If it’s due to ongoing foundation movement, a simple seal might not be a permanent fix, and addressing the underlying issue is necessary. Consulting a professional can help identify the root cause.

What is the difference between waterproofing and damp-proofing?

Waterproofing provides a barrier that prevents liquid water from penetrating your foundation walls. Damp-proofing, on the other hand, is a less robust method that only resists low-level moisture and vapor. For significant water intrusion issues or areas with high water tables, true waterproofing is essential.

Does grading around my house affect basement waterproofing?

Absolutely. Proper grading that slopes away from your foundation is one of the most critical first lines of defense against basement water. Poor grading allows water to pool against your foundation, increasing hydrostatic pressure and the likelihood of leaks, even with a good waterproofing system in place.

How do I know if I need interior or exterior waterproofing?

The choice between interior and exterior waterproofing depends on several factors, including the severity of the water problem, the type of foundation, the surrounding landscape, and budget. Exterior waterproofing is generally more effective at stopping water at the source but is significantly more expensive. Interior systems manage water that enters, making them a common and effective solution for many homes. A professional inspection can help determine the best approach for your specific situation.
